@Coffeeglitch But they never did that with it. They clarified that back in October.

"Responding to a YouTube comment regarding the hero-shooter rumors, Bungie emphasized that Marathon’s Runners will have a “couple of base abilities” with a focus on player freedom and individuality, where each player can fine-tune their loadouts and abilities instead of picking from preset “hero” characters with assigned abilities. “Our goal with Runners is to give you a couple of base abilities to build your loadout around while still giving you a lot of freedom to choose what weapons, implants, upgrades, and consumables you bring in,” the developer explained. “This won’t feel like when you just choose a hero and then get whatever weapon/abilities are assigned to them.”"
